After showing her face for the first time in an interview with Piers Morgan, the lawyer Fiona Harveywho claims to be the Martha portrayed in the hit series “Baby Rena”, revealed how much he received to talk to the journalist. The interview airs this Thursday (9), on YouTube.

To the Daily RecordFiona said that Piers Morgan paid her £250, around of R$1,592, for her first video appearance. She also commented that she is very uncomfortable with the content of the interview. The woman, who guarantees that she was never arrested as shown in the seriesexplained that the journalist tried to catch her off guard.

“There was a lot of emphasis on the emails I allegedly sent. I have my own ideas about this, which I would like to keep to myself, but I wouldn’t say I’m happy. He [Morgan] He was too quick to try to trip me. He did it quickly to catch me off guard,” he stated.

Fiona added: “Piers kept saying, ‘Are you sure you didn’t send 41,000 emails and make calls to this guy?’ For a large part of the interview, about ten minutes, he was hammering this out. I said, ‘Look, even if I sent a few emails, that doesn’t mean I’m to blame for everything else.’ As I said, to consider ‘Baby Reindeer’ as a true story, it has to be 100% true. It seemed like he [Piers] was prepared. I feel a little used. He asked me if I loved Richard Gadd and I said, ‘You’ve got to be kidding.’”she complained.

According to what the presenter shared on social media, Fiona Harvey will tell her side of the story. “The real-life Martha reveals herself and gives her first TV interview about the hit Netflix series. Fiona Harvey wants to give her opinion and ‘set the record straight’. Is she a psychopathic stalker? Find out tomorrow”he wrote.

“Baby Reindeer” revolves around the experiences of Richard Gadd, who was stalked by a woman for four years. At the time, the artist received 41,071 emails, 350 hours of voicemails, 744 tweets, 46 Facebook messages and 106 pages of letters. Find out more about the story here.

With seven episodes, the production is emerging as the new streaming phenomenon and will have a reinforced campaign for the Emmys.
